1. Historian
A historian is someone who researches and writes approximately the past.
Historians use loads of assets, including number-one sources like letters
and diaries and secondary purchases like books and articles, to apprehend
and interpret ancient occasions. Historians might specialize in a specific
3. time, geographic region, or subject matter, including army records or
science records.
A few skills required to be a historian in India are:
Analysis of data
Ability to communicate
Solve queries
Collaborate with colleagues
Proficiency in Writing
Top recruiters for Historian in India:
All India Handicrafts Board, the Ministry of Education, and the departments
of tourism
Indian Council of Cultural Relations (ICCR)
Indian Council of Historical Research (ICHR)
Indian National Trust for Art and Cultural Heritage (INTACH)
National Archives of India
Colleges and Universities teaching Archaeology, Museology, and History
Private Museums, Public Museums
Curators with different Historical monuments
Salary: The average salary of a historian in India is Rs 3,45,000/annum.
4. 2. Museology
What is museology?
Museology is a look at museums and their function in society. This
discipline encompasses an extensive range of topics, from museums'
records to their position in schooling, cultural protection, and network
improvement. Museology is likewise concerned with controlling, business
enterprise, and presenting museum collections.
Skills required to be a museologist in India:
Knowledge of History and artwork
Strong communication
Attention to the element
Curatorship talents
Technological proficiency
Project and time management
Language Proficiency
Ability to work in a team
Top recruiters for Museologists in India:
Government Museum, Bangalore
Government Museum and Art Gallery, Chandigarh
Government Museum, Chennai
Library of Tibetan Works and Archives, Dharamshala
Salarjung Museum, Hyderabad
Birla Industrial & Technological Museum, Kolkata
Gurusaday Museum, Kolkata
5. Shankar’s International Dolls Museum, New Delhi
Asiatic Society Museum, Kolkata
Asutosh Museum of Indian Art, Kolkata
Gandhi Memorial Museum, Madurai
Salary: The average salary of a museologist in India is Rs
2,00,000/annum.
3. Archivist
Archivists are Information experts specifically knowledgeable about
preserving source records and helping people acquire them. Archivists are
responsible for evaluating, maintaining, and organizing statistics and files.
They control books, letters, antique images, audio recordings, and other
objects, relying on their information, and save them over the years using an
organizing gadget that lets in for green retrieval.
Skills required to be an archivist in India:
Analysis of records
Ability to talk
Collaborate with colleagues
Expertise in Writing skills
